Output 0f95184b511cbdeae290c41affc5e7b5fbcf4962a04ca054daed49ddbf9bcb28:8

value
8539619
script pubkey
OP_0 OP_PUSHBYTES_20 935e236566777467b83be4304e63abc4ff1f799c
address
bc1qjd0zxetxwa6x0wpmuscyucatcnl377vuzw08wc
transaction
0f95184b511cbdeae290c41affc5e7b5fbcf4962a04ca054daed49ddbf9bcb28
confirmations
151204
spent
false